About the role
- The e-Billing Analyst will be responsible for all aspects of invoice submissions via various e-billing platforms and resolving e-billing issues for the law firm's e-billed clients.
- The role requires various interactions with all levels of management, amid a fast-paced, deadline driven environment.
- Commensurate experience may be considered in lieu of education, based upon candidate's overall employment history
Responsibilities
- Financial Support Service Manager, Financial Support Services Supervisor, Account Manager, or Account Supervisor
- This position works closely with the Financial Support Services team
- Responsible for the submission of electronic invoices and accruals to clients on monthly basis, overseeing the transition of clients to e-billing, and providing follow-up support to attorneys, and clients in all aspects related to electronic billing
- Act as liaison between billing attorney/secretarial staff, and clients' staff assigned to electronic billing by providing expert level subject matter support
- Populate, maintain, and update data for assigned clients in the billing system and clients' external web applications; ensure all relevant information is updated and correlated in the firm's billing system
- Work collaboratively with department's supervisor to support e-billing systems by adding/removing user accounts, resetting passwords, assigning proper security levels, entering budgets, status reports, and matter profiles in various sub-systems
- Perform ad hoc analyses of complex client accounts regarding collections, rates, and reduced and rejected invoices

Requirements
- Excellent communication and a high level of professional service to management, attorneys and other staff is required to succeed in this role.
- Must have a high level of customer service, professionalism, and interpersonal skills.
Nice to have
- Associate Degree or advanced degree preferred with concentration in Business, Accounting, or Finance.
- Minimum two years of hands-on e-Billing experience in a law-firm or professional organization required.
- Four years of experience preferred.
- Aderant, Elite, LawTime (or equivalent) legal accounting software experience.
- Hands on familiarity with multiple e-billing vendor systems and outside counsel guidelines.
- Strong technology and office skills, including advanced proficiency in Excel, Word and Outlook, and ability to create, edit, and present complex data, analyses, and ad hoc reports.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ills along with an aptitude for working with numbers and being a team player.
- Detail-oriented with a customer service approach and attitude for problem-solving.
